Companies Who Specialize in Making Log Siding for Residential Purposes

Many of us love the look and feel of wood houses. For others owning a home that is built from wood or logs is dream. While the cost of building your home from full logs may be very expensive, there is an alternative in log siding. This type of siding can be found in many homes and there are very few people who can tell the difference between the siding and full cut logs.

Corn Cob Blasting - The Best Method of Stripping and Removing Failing Finish and UV Damage From Log Homes and Cabins

Corn-Cob Blasting-the best option for stripping log home and cabin finishes!

-Generally, corn cob blasting is the best overall method of dealing with many log related problems. Some other method’s for removal of failing finishes, sun-burned wood, mold and mildew issues, etc., are sand blasting or chemical stripping. Log Cabin Fever

Homesteaders settling in the territories of the American West traditionally built log cabins; durable, rainproof, and inexpensive. Today, eco-friendly and rustically charming, log cabins with their distinctive handcrafted appearance seem to be making a comeback, with luxurious features such as whirlpools, skylight windows and heated patios.
